    Il verde nella casa dell’uomo “compendio di gioie essenziali” / Nature in Homes, a “compendium of essential joys”

    No full text
    Nel 1950 Luigi Figini pubblica L’elemento “verde” e l’abitazione: il contributo più rilevante e più appassionato sul rapporto tra costruito, natura, modi di vivere, da parte di un architetto del razionalismo italiano. Guardando alla storia e pensando al presente, egli sviluppa le riflessioni maturate nel periodo tra le due guerre e traccia un itinerario originale tra il verde e il progetto moderno; ne identifica le componenti, illustra esempi e propone soluzioni, lasciando un messaggio di grande significato e attualità per la cultura architettonica: allora come oggi. Il libro è riproposto in edizione anastatica per rispettare non solo il testo, ma anche le scelte grafiche di Figini, ed è arricchito da un’introduzione di Ornella Selvafolta (in italiano e inglese) che ne spiega l’origine in rapporto alle esperienze architettoniche, culturali e artistiche dell’autore. In 1950 Luigi Figini published the book L’elemento “verde” e l’abitazione (The element of ‘Nature’ and Dwellings: the most important and most fervent contribution about the relationship between architecture and nature, by an architect of the Italian Rationalism. Linking history to the present, he brings to maturity ideas and experiences of the Thirties and traces an original route between green, home, and modern architecture, showing examples and proposing solutions, thus leaving a message of great significance and relevance for architectural culture and practice: then and now. The book is presented in a facsimile edition to meet not only the text, but also the graphical choices by Figini, and is introduced by an essay of Ornella Selvafolta that explains its origin in relation to the architectural experiences and culture of the author

    Le fabbriche di Figini e Pollini: da Olivetti alla Manifattura Ceramica Pozzi

    No full text
    One of the most emblematic moment in the Figini and Pollini’s career as architects is the meeting with Adriano Olivetti, director of the homonymous factory in Ivrea and author of what can be considered the main stage in the evolution of the relationship between architecture and the industrial sector. A connection characterized by him with a more humanistic attitude, aimed at protecting the natural environment and improving the well-being of workers and of the whole society as well. The first originates from Milan, the second born in Rovereto, they fulfill and complement each other. An indivisible couple starting from the youth projects culminated in the ‘Electric house’ designed for the Triennale in Monza in 1930 as an authentic manifesto of a new architecture. During the V Triennale the three met for the first time, sharing from the beginning the need to go back to a rational and tradition path after the delirium of the war, which is just ended. Both the part support the spiritual value of creation, looking with hope at what is already happening in the ‘new world’, the United States. Thus, while Olivetti develops a program to renovate and valorize the industry from a political and social point of view, Figini and Pollini give shape to his ideas, transforming a workplace into the ideal community project for contemporary civilization. An ideal civilization that a few years later they will try to settle in the south of the country too, taking part in the Sparanise conversion project – a small village close to Caserta – from an agricultural area into an industrial site thanks to the establishment of the Manifattura Ceramica Pozzi. A project that, even if failed in its attempt to last, allows the two of them to see the vision of an ‘anti-city’, previously matured along their research, achieved. Made real here, through a factory conceived as an ideal harmonic dimension, marked by the search for a constant dialogue with nature, such as extension of the architecture itself

    The Construction of Field in Science Popularization Stories

    Get PDF
    Systemic Functional Linguistics proposes a model of language that views texts as context-situated social activities. Context is modeled into two levels: context of culture which accounts for variation according to genre, and context of situation which accounts for variations according to three dimensions: field, tenor and mode. The register variable field, understood as the way in which a particular domain of experience is construed and organized through ideational meanings, is explored in a corpus of science popularization stories. The aim is to understand how science as a social activity is represented in these texts and to gain insights on how this approach can be useful in English as a Foreign Language reading courses in university environments. The data collected From a corpus of 60 popularization articles from the science popularization website Science Daily, including 30 stories extracted from the subsection Fitness in the Health section and 30 from the Chemistry Section, we randomly selected 10 stories from each field. One component of the Rhetorical Structure (Presentation of the Popularized Research) is selected to identify entities, activities and qualities through an analysis of Transitivity. Taxonomies are constructed related to the following entities: researchers, institutions, research reports, and research. The results show how the fields of doing science and reporting science are construed in this component through the description of those entities and the activities they are involved in. Pedagogical implications are suggested in relation to the design of pedagogical materials in EFL university reading courses

    The construction of field in science popularization stories and their source research articles: implications for reading courses at university level.

    No full text
    This research was conducted under the premise that the development of advanced scientific literacy, a major concern at university education, is fundamentally related to the reading of scientific texts, and therefore, it should be included as one of the objectives in English as a Foreign Language (EFL) reading courses of disciplinary texts. Science popularization articles directly sourced from research articles may be an appealing resource for combining the development of EFL reading strategies and the construction of scientific knowledge. The purpose of this work was to analyze a corpus of science popularization stories published under the topic Fitness in the Science Daily website (sub-corpus 1) and their source research articles (sub-corpus 2) in order to identify different degrees of complexity in the construction of the field, understood as “the domain of experience the text relates to” (Halliday and Matthiessen, 2014). Each sub-corpus was analyzed in search of 1) the lexical units which introduce and realize participants in the clauses of the Title and Abstract of each article and 2) the lexical chains that enable participants to be tracked, construed by the resources of repetition, synonymy, hyponymy and meronymy. Our hypothesis is that research articles will be more complex as regards number of participants presented in the Title and Abstract and the semantic density of the lexical units that realize them, but science popularization texts may present more instances of synonymy –rather than lexical repetition- as a resource to track participants, which may make them more lexically complex for nonnative readers. Considering the possible use of these texts as reading materials and taking into account the relevance of lexis in reading comprehension processes (e.g. Grabe and Stoller 2002), this study aims to unveil difficulties inherent to the reading of each of these genres that should be addressed in reading comprehension courses

    Periferie d'autore. Il quartiere Feltre a Milano 1961-2019

    No full text
    LAUREA MAGISTRALE-Over the past two years the City of Milan has demonstrated an increasing interest as regards the suburbs, reaching in 2017 the definition of a specific plan, Piano Periferie, located in five areas within the City, then become ambiti prioritari PP of the latest and wider Piano Quartieri, developed in 2018. Given the presence of multiple diverse factors, we assumed as necessary to explore these delicate sites, going over the concept of suburbs through time and afterwards pointing out 20th century author architecture and neighborhoods, making the intersection of these examples with the boundaries defined by the urban planning. This phase led to the creation of the Periferie d’autore map, using a geographic information system GIS, that enabled to gather and classify data and documentary materials concerning each of the indicated architecture and neighborhoods. The outcomes of this large-scale study proved to be useful for identifying the specific case study, Quartiere Ina-Casa in via Feltre, designed between 1957 and 1961 thanks to the cooperation of many teamworks featuring famous architects such as Gino Pollini (coordinator) and Luigi Figini, Ignazio Gardella, Luciano Baldessari, Giancarlo De Carlo, Vittorio Gregotti, Mario Terzaghi and Augusto Magnaghi, Mario Bacciocchi, Angelo Mangiarotti and Bruno Morassutti, Tito Varisco Bassanesi, Gianluigi Giordani and Pier Italo Trolli. The residential complex analysis was structured into several way, starting from the examination of the unique achitecture features, the techniques and materials used in the construction phase, considering published and unpublished sources. Meanwhile we proceeded to on-site research, facing with the population through qualitative interviews, showing the current conservation status and retracing the visible transformations referred to the elevations of the buildings. We decided ideed to bring attention to the outside areas since the existing environmental constraint doesn’t seem to have accomplished the intended effects, according to the multiple modifications that have been occurred despite the activation of the protection measure in 2008. In order to enhance the effectiveness of the constraint and reactivate the neighborhood context, we proposed several guidelines referring to a multidisciplinary and different scale based method, which brought to the development of an integrated project. This approach, focused on the interaction of an integrated logic and a uniform direction, that involves citizens and the local authority, could be proposed as a model for future operations within author suburbs areas

    The factory for workers. Olivetti in Spain

    No full text
    Adriano Olivetti, the “Italian Rathenau”, was the author of an ambitious industrial plan that had no equals in the productive scenario of the country, managing to balance between the scientific organization of the work, proposed by the models of Fordism and Taylorism, and the social issues that focused primarily on the working class conditions. A new conception of production spaces, an original configuration for the underdeveloped Italian context, was crucial for the fulfilment of Adriano’s plan: he conceived a factory as a cosy place which was able to accommodate the arrangement of new assembly lines, experimented by the company located in Ivrea near Turin, and to guarantee at the same time comfortable and suitable spaces for the workers. With a view to subverting the mechanistic alienation induced by the Taylorism, well stigmatized by Chaplin in his movie “Modern Times”, Adriano assigned a key role to architecture and in particular to the proposals of Modern Movement, that could support the conception and the development of a new form of factory. These are the reasons that led to the construction of the new complex in Ivrea designed by Figini and Pollini in the early 1930s, followed by other realisations a few years later, like the big factory in Barcelona, designed by Italo Lauro and Josep Soteras i Mauri. The Spanish industries, built for the new company branch Hispano Olivetti, were innovative buildings, designed with environmental parameters and equipped not only with systems and work spaces, but also with canteens, sport facilities and other services for workers, that certainly improve their work-life in this urban microcosm. The same arrangement was followed for the other industries involved in the great expansion plan directed by Adriano Olivetti that led to the construction of several factories beyond the borders of Italy, like the industries built in Argentina and Brasil after the second world war with the projects of Marco Zanuso. The contribution retraces the history of Hispano Olivetti, trying to focus on the differences and the similarities between Italian and Spanish factories built by the Piedmontese company, in order to understand how corporate policies inspired and guided the project of meaningful modern architectures, developed far from the well-known epicentres of the Modern Movement, but still used nowadays in their cities, after the abandonment and the reconversion of the buildings due to the intense downsizing of the company in 1990s

    TORBEAM 2.0, a paraxial beam tracing code for electron-cyclotron beams in fusion plasmas for extended physics applications

    Get PDF
    The paraxial WKB code TORBEAM (Poli, 2001) is widely used for the description of electron-cyclotron waves in fusion plasmas, retaining diffraction effects through the solution of a set of ordinary differential equations. With respect to its original form, the code has undergone significant transformations and extensions, in terms of both the physical model and the spectrum of applications. The code has been rewritten in Fortran 90 and transformed into a library, which can be called from within different (not necessarily Fortran-based) workflows. The models for both absorption and current drive have been extended, including e.g. fully-relativistic calculation of the absorption coefficient, momentum conservation in electron–electron collisions and the contribution of more than one harmonic to current drive. The code can be run also for reflectometry applications, with relativistic corrections for the electron mass. Formulas that provide the coupling between the reflected beam and the receiver have been developed. Accelerated versions of the code are available, with the reduced physics goal of inferring the location of maximum absorption (including or not the total driven current) for a given setting of the launcher mirrors. Optionally, plasma volumes within given flux surfaces and corresponding values of minimum and maximum magnetic field can be provided externally to speed up the calculation of full driven-current profiles. These can be employed in real-time control algorithms or for fast data analysis.</p

    Safety and anti-tumour activity of the IgE antibody MOv18 in patients with advanced solid tumours expressing folate receptor-alpha: a phase I trial

    Get PDF
    \ua9 2023, The Author(s).All antibodies approved for cancer therapy are monoclonal IgGs but the biology of IgE, supported by comparative preclinical data, offers the potential for enhanced effector cell potency. Here we report a Phase I dose escalation trial (NCT02546921) with the primary objective of exploring the safety and tolerability of MOv18 IgE, a chimeric first-in-class IgE antibody, in patients with tumours expressing the relevant antigen, folate receptor-alpha. The trial incorporated skin prick and basophil activation tests (BAT) to select patients at lowest risk of allergic toxicity. Secondary objectives were exploration of anti-tumour activity, recommended Phase II dose, and pharmacokinetics. Dose escalation ranged from 70 μg–12 mg. The most common toxicity of MOv18 IgE is transient urticaria. A single patient experienced anaphylaxis, likely explained by detection of circulating basophils at baseline that could be activated by MOv18 IgE. The BAT assay was used to avoid enrolling further patients with reactive basophils. The safety profile is tolerable and maximum tolerated dose has not been reached, with evidence of anti-tumour activity observed in a patient with ovarian cancer. These results demonstrate the potential of IgE therapy for cancer

    Opportunity costs of trade-related capacity development in Sub-Saharan Africa

    No full text
    Includes bibliographical references.Recent studies have documented the impact of institutions and infrastructure development on trade flows. This paper studies these issues in the context 010n90in9 trade-related capacity building initiatives and evaluates the opportunity cost of different trade-related capacity building policy mixes. Trade-related technical assistance and capacity building was recognized in 2001 by the World Trade Organisation Doha Ministerial Declaration as a core element of the development dimension of the multilateral trading system and commitments were set out in those areas. The extentof trade-related technical assistance and capacity building to help developing and least developed countries participate more efficiently in international trade has increased by 50% between 2001 and 2004. The purpose of this thesis is to address the question of whether the weights assigned to different components of trade-related capacity building in existing trade-related capacity building programmes are economically justified. To do this the paper evaluates the opportunity costsof different trade-related capacity building policy mixes with specific reference to Sub-Saharan Africa, excluding South Africa. We use a number of variables from both theoretical and empirical literature to come up with composite indicators for trade-related institutions, infrastructure and human capital. The analysis is also informed by interviews with trade experts in Geneva as well as a review of relevant background documents. In the empirical analysis we use 2005 trade patterns for a data set of 117 countries of which 24 are in sub-Saharan Africa. Making use ofa gravity equation augmented with trade-related capacity building variables we run a series of Heckman's two-step selection regressions and estimate the marginal impacts of these trade-related capacity building indicators on trade as measured by value of total exports. To evaluate opportunity costs. we do policy simulations and estimate how much trade flows will be increased under various policy scenarios with respect to improved trade-related capacity building indicators in Sub-Saharan Africa. We examine scenarios that focus on improved institutions. infrastructure and human capital as they move in the direction of comparability with the rest of the world. The world's average level is used as the baseline for each of these composite indicators in the policy simulations. The results show that trade flows exhibit different levels of sensitivity to different trade-related capacity building policy options with the exporter's infrastructure being the most significant with an average elasticity of approximately 3.0. The findings also suggest that complementing improvements in the quality of human capital and infrastructure will provide the greatest bilateral trade flow benefit to Sub-Saharan Africa; while non-Sub-Saharan Africa countries gain the most from complementing infrastructure and institutions. Such a finding contradicts the current focus of ongoing TReB programmes that put emphasis on human capital development only. Building on both Grossman and Helpman (1991),s trade model and Barro (1990) s' growth model, the paper argues that the theoretical propositions are inadequate to address the dynamics associated with trade-related capacity building policy. The paper further argues that analyzing the impact of rReB using these standard frameworks underestimates the impact since policy dynamics are not addressed in that framework. This could contribute to explaining why there has not been consensus in the trade-growth empirical literature, with some authors finding a positive and significant impact of trade on growth, while others argue that the impact is not significant Hence, the paper proposes improvements in the specification of the standard growth model to take into account policy dynamics, specifically assumptions regarding substitutability among TRee investments
